Assistant Site Supervisor (Mechanic), Teleport Campus
New York City Economic Development Corporation is committed to creating a vibrant, inclusive, and globally competitive economy for all New Yorkers. The Assistant Site Supervisor will oversee the Operations and Maintenance of City-owned properties, ensuring that facilities are properly maintained and operational needs are met.

Responsibilities
Perform preventive maintenance, repairs, and emergency services on EDC properties as directed, including but not limited to low voltage electrical equipment/systems, plumbing, heating ventilation and air conditioner (HVAC), mechanical systems, carpentry, painting, masonry and other general repair needs
Partner with EDC Facility Director to ensure that the campus and its facilities are routinely inspected, and work orders are logged appropriately in accordance with EDC requirements
Ensure direct reports are properly tasked and equipped to log and perform scheduled inspections and work orders that occur at the campus
Assist in management of on-site EDC Field Staff and contracted retainer workers
Support and aid in the coordination of contactor site visits and/or repairs
Ensure appropriate coverage and overlap among EDC/contracted staff at the campus
Provide support after working hours for efforts such as contractor escort, site visits and other EDC planned events as needed
During snow events that require removal duties, partner with the team to establish logistics plans to address removal duties and coordinate with appropriate contractors to ensure there is coverage
This is an onsite position that requires a 5-day presence at the Teleport Campus with travel to our main office at One Liberty Plaza as needed
Work schedule may include weekend coverage and is subject to manager approval/consideration
Other duties as assigned
Qualification
Required
High School diploma or equivalent
3+ years of experience required with working knowledge in maintenance, inspections and repairs
Ability to use handheld and desktop computer devices to enter work orders and document completed work
Valid New York State Commercial Driver License (CDL) with a clean driving record, maintained throughout employment
Working knowledge of construction and handyman repair techniques
Ability to push, pull, and carry objects required to perform job duties
Experience using hand and power tools, materials, and equipment associated with construction-related trades
Ability to communicate effectively in verbal and written formats; proficiency with Microsoft Word and Outlook; experience using two-way radios and smartphones
New York City residence is required within 180 days of hire
